What's nuts is that since July I've had 3 failures in this one circuit. 1. Loose connector. 2. Broken splice connection 3. Missing (yes missing) Tow Tail fuse. I have no idea how the Tow Tail fuse went missing. I can only assume that my Dissent tail lights never worked. I had brake and blinkers just know tail lights. I only noticed the no tail lights when I hooked up a trailer at night in October. The first thing I did was check the fuses but I wasn't actually looking at the right fuse.Nice! Too bad no one thought to tell you to check that fuse… especially in the 3rd post30A Towing fuse is not the same as the 30 A Tow Tail fuse.

Could be wrong, but i think this has been gone over before. i believe the adapter is "designed" to connect back near the resonator on the USA driver's side, even though it can be clipped in at a block on the passenger side. But as you found, when clipped in on the passenger side, the wires do not match up.This thread saved me a bunch of time fixing my trailer running light issues thank you!
On top of the tow tail fuse being blown, I also managed to get a brand new lx570 specific hopkins adapter that had the batt+ and brake wires flipped, and non-functioning left hand turn.
